How to help Douglas tree? It grew from old tree stump. Maybe 3 years old. The middle spike was clipped can it still grow? Sending photo. Thanks.

Multnomah County Oregon

Expert Response

Hi Summer and thanks for your question and picture of your Douglas Fir seedling. Yes, it will still grow as one of the side branches will arch up and become the top, but it will not be as strong as if it had a complete top.

 I'm also concerned about how near it seems to be to the rock and the sidewalk. It will get to be very large with an extensive root system, so if you want to try raising it, it might be better to move it to somewhere it can reach out roots to at least a 30 foot circle.

Another option is to let it grow to about 6 feet and keep it trimmed for a future Christmas tree. It might not be the perfect shape, but it will be yours!
